In a race likely to throw up any number of future winners, FALCON NINE gets the marginal vote. Despite being easy to back and very much held back by inexperience on debut at Leicester, he shaped with plenty of promise and can be expected to take a big step forward. Uncle's Newbury introduction was similarly promising and he is also open to significant improvement, while Racingbreaks Ryder and Muktamil are others with strong claims, and a market move for any of the newcomers would be noteworthy.
